
A girl posts this wall-of-text story about her crush (짝남 = guy she likes) at what seems to be a girls' tournament/event. She was the coordinator, and while cheering, she notices her crush is way taller than her and she's feeling flustered. She'd brought a moisturizer (수분크림) and — in a total 'this will never work' move — offers it to him. He says he doesn't have any, so she tells him to use hers.
Fast forward: he texts her that night asking for the moisturizer brand. Then the NEXT day he actually buys it and sends her a photo. They keep texting. He starts sending her face selfies. She spirals — 'is he ugly? is he testing me??' — but no, turns out he's actually kind of intimidating-looking but fun. They've now been texting nonstop for 3 days straight.
The caption she added: 'Can you really flirt using moisturizer?? I guess people who are meant to make it happen can do it with ANYTHING. Does that mean I'm just someone things never work out for no matter what I try??? 😭'
